Subject: Skyhopper unit back for servicing

Hi Dalia,

Quick heads-up: the Skyhopper M4 that was flying the Renwick loop came back this morning with a wobbly gimbal, so it's off rotation until the techs at Fennel Works sign it off. Should be two or three days tops. When the courier collects it tomorrow, make sure they follow the pickup protocol exactly. The hand-over instruction is below.

handover note for yagef-bagep: the drudor pelius courier leaves the kasdor zorvan norir ledger at gate 8016 under passcode 755406

Subject: On-call intro — Pedalshift rebalancer

Welcome aboard. Pedalshift moves bike inventory predictions between depots nightly; from a security standpoint, the sensitive part is the depot-credential vault it reads at startup. Alerts mostly mean stale forecasts, not breaches, but treat any vault-access anomaly as priority one. The threat model and escalation steps are documented on the internal page.

dashboard of yahaf-kajep = https://jira.zemvarsys.internal/display/projects/browse/browse/a08b

Ticket #—: Sprinkle scheduler skipping Tuesday cycles

Hey support crew — customers on the GreenRoot plant-watering scheduler are reporting that Tuesday watering runs vanish after a timezone change. We traced it to the recurrence engine dropping events that cross a DST boundary. Fix is ready and tested against the Fernwick greenhouse account; zones rehydrate correctly now. Please hold off telling customers it's resolved until the patch ships Thursday. This one needs a formal sign-off before release, and that falls to:

named custodian: Brivan Eliath Quenox Frador